What's Midori Ward like?
If you want to find the perfect part of the city to explore, consider Midori Ward. Nature lovers can visit Kanagawa Prefectural Lake Tsukui Shiroyama Park and Meiji Memorial Forest Takao Quasi-National Park. There's plenty more to see, including Lake Sagami Pleasure Forest and Kanagawa Prefectural Sagamiko Exchange Center.
